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Rugeley Trent Valley to Dorchester West start from as little as £46.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Rugeley Trent Valley to Dorchester West start from £100.30 one way, or £143.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Rugeley Trent Valley to Dorchester West are available for £156.70 one way, or £313.20 return

While Rugeley Trent Valley may not rival the grandeur of some larger stations, it’s well-equipped for those who seek simplicity and efficiency. Although there is no ticket office, the station offers ticket machines where travelers can collect tickets purchased online, ensuring a smooth start to your journey. The machines cater to everyone, offering accessible features such as induction loops and are equipped for smartcard usage, even though smartcards are not issued at this station.

Facilities and Amenities

Despite its compact size, Rugeley Trent Valley station is dedicated to supporting its passengers, especially when it comes to accessibility. The station boasts step-free access through certain parts, making it easier for passengers with mobility challenges to navigate. Although the toilets and waiting room facilities are limited, the seating area provides a comfortable spot to relax while waiting for your train. Plus, with CCTV coverage, security is another aspect taken seriously here.

For those who prefer cycling to driving, the station offers bicycle storage with 16 spaces and CCTV security, perfect for eco-conscious travelers. Meanwhile, motorists will find the SABA UK-operated car park handy, offering 19 parking spaces, including one accessible space.

Getting Around and Onward Travel

Once you’ve arrived at Rugeley Trent Valley, onward travel is straightforward. If your journey is disrupted, a rail replacement service operates from the station car park. For further convenience, taxi services are readily available through local providers such as RGL Station Aline and Chase. While the direct bus links are limited, a printable format of routes and timetables is accessible online, making it easy to plan your journey comprehensively.

Facilities and Amenities

While Dorchester West station might be modest in size, it has a wealth of essential features. However, travelers should note that there is no ticket office or machines on site, so it's wise to purchase your tickets in advance online. An induction loop is present to aid those who are hearing impaired. For those needing assistance, helpful staff can be reached via a dedicated help point. Although there are no dedicated facilities for waiting or shopping, there's a seating area where you can rest while waiting for your train. CCTV is operational, ensuring your safety during your visit.

Access and Assistance

Accessibility at Dorchester West station is quite accommodating although there are limitations. The platforms provide step-free access through public footpaths, though transitioning between platforms via the footbridge involves stairs. However, a ramp is available for train access, allowing ease for those with mobility needs. It's worth mentioning that no accessible taxis or designated set-down/pick-up points are present, so planning your journey with these considerations in mind is important.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Beyond the station, Dorchester West connects to various transport services. Local market bus stops along Maumbury Road provide convenient rail replacement services when needed. Reaching the nearest airport from this station involves additional travel plans, as detailed information is not readily available. With no facilities for car hire directly at the station, planning ahead is beneficial for those requiring further travel assistance.
